//_____________________________________________________________________________
template <>
template <>
inline G4bool G4TNtupleManager<tools::wroot::ntuple, G4RootFile>::FillNtupleTColumn(
G4int ntupleId, G4int columnId, const std::string& value)
{
if ( fState.GetIsActivation() && ( ! GetActivation(ntupleId) ) ) {
//G4cout << "Skipping FillNtupleIColumn for " << ntupleId << G4endl;
return false;
}
auto ntuple = GetNtupleInFunction(ntupleId, "FillNtupleTColumn");
if ( ! ntuple ) return false;
auto index = columnId - fFirstNtupleColumnId;
if ( index < 0 || index >= G4int(ntuple->columns().size()) ) {
G4ExceptionDescription description;
description << " " << "ntupleId " << ntupleId
<< " columnId " << columnId << " does not exist.";
G4Exception("G4RootNtupleManager::FillNtupleTColumn()",
"Analysis_W011", JustWarning, description);
return false;
}
auto icolumn = ntuple->columns()[index];
auto column = dynamic_cast<tools::wroot::ntuple::column_string* >(icolumn);
if ( ! column ) {
G4ExceptionDescription description;
description << " Column type does not match: "
<< " ntupleId " << ntupleId
<< " columnId " << columnId << " value " << value;
G4Exception("G4RootNtupleManager:FillNtupleColumn",
"Analysis_W011", JustWarning, description);
return false;
}
column->fill(value);
#ifdef G4VERBOSE
if ( fState.GetVerboseL4() ) {
G4ExceptionDescription description;
description << " ntupleId " << ntupleId
<< " columnId " << columnId << " value " << value;
fState.GetVerboseL4()->Message("fill", "ntuple T column", description);
}
#endif
return true;
}
